Solution for x^2-11x-6x=0 equation:



x^2-11x-6x=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
x^2-17x=0
a = 1; b = -17; c = 0;
Δ = b2-4ac
Δ = -172-4·1·0
Δ = 289
The delta value is higher than zero, so the equation has two solutions
We use following formulas to calculate our solutions:
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$

$\sqrt{\Delta}=\sqrt{289}=17$
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-17)-17}{2*1}=\frac{0}{2} =0 $
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-17)+17}{2*1}=\frac{34}{2} =17 $
